fre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計-基于單片機的全自動洗衣機控制系統(tǒng)設(shè)計-文庫吧資料

2025-01-23 01:06本頁面
  

【正文】 NG RUNINA02: test (flag5).0 ;排脫水 25 jr t,RUNIA1 ; test (flag4).7 ; 7s 程序,最好 jr t,RUNIA1 ; call del7s jp RUNING RUNIA1: call RUNDISP ; 1m 修改一 個運行時間 test (flag5).3 ;洗衣結(jié)束 jr f,RUNIA2 call xiyi ;調(diào)洗衣程序 RUNIA3: jp RUNING RUNIA2: test (flag1).1 ;蜂鳴器正在工作 jr f,RUNIA3 test (flag6).3 ;循環(huán)檢測程序 jr f,RUNIA4 RUNIA5: call workini1 ;初始化 RUNIA4: set (flag2).3 ;程序初始化 clr (flag5).3 ;洗衣結(jié)束,結(jié)束蜂鳴 jp RUNING 。如果沒有他們的無私支持和指導,相信我沒有辦法完成這次的畢業(yè)設(shè)計。在四年的學習中,他們不僅給我傳授了系統(tǒng)的理論知識,培養(yǎng)了較強的動手實驗能力,而且還通過言傳身教潛移默化地傳授給我做人的道 理。從選題、方案論證到具體設(shè)計和論文撰寫的各個環(huán)節(jié),都得到老師的熱心指導、幫助、和指正,使得我能在比較正確的軌道上,在預期的時間內(nèi)完成工作量較大的課題,對此將深深感謝老師的幫助。 本文是在老師指導下完成的。 本次設(shè)計對與我來說是一次對自己性格鍛煉,它讓我充分的認識自己所學習知識的不夠,讓我明白小事、小細節(jié)對于全局的重要性,使我認識到自己的學習和生活的關(guān)系,讓我知道自己以 后做事的態(tài)度和行為,所以本次設(shè)計對我自身的是起到很重要的審視作用。 在本次設(shè)計中,因為以前的時候總是覺得設(shè)計只要有總體思路就可以了,所以在設(shè)計電路的時候,特別是對雙向晶閘管的使用的 時候,只是從書上了解到了無觸點的優(yōu)點但是卻沒有想到其實雙向晶閘管的過壓和過流性是十分的脆弱的,設(shè)計的時候就直接用它去控制了電機和電磁閥,這樣的穩(wěn)定性在實際的使用中不能穩(wěn)定使用,所以設(shè)計沒有實際意義。由于其具有內(nèi)存容量大、輸入輸出口多、 I/O的驅(qū)動能力強、指令系統(tǒng)豐富等特點,將其應用在家用電器控制中,可大大簡化系統(tǒng)的硬件電路,使系統(tǒng)具有更高的可靠性。脫水程序模塊如圖 44所示。NNYYNNN返回滅漂洗燈清漂洗標志清四漂標志第四次漂洗子程序第四次漂洗?清三漂標志第三次漂洗?調(diào)三漂子程序返回清二漂標志Y調(diào)二漂子程序第二次漂洗?清一漂標志Y調(diào)一漂子程序第一次漂洗?Y漂洗燈閃爍允許漂洗?程序入口 圖 43 漂洗程序模塊框圖 20 脫水程序模塊 脫水是洗衣過程中可有可無的環(huán)節(jié)。當用戶 選擇漂洗過程后,此標志有效。 NY返回清除主洗標志滅主洗燈調(diào)脫水子程序設(shè)置脫水時間返回允許主洗?調(diào)排水子程序調(diào)主洗洗滌子程序主洗燈閃爍調(diào)進水子程序程序入口 圖 42 主洗程序模塊 19 漂洗程序模塊 在洗衣機上電后默認漂洗次數(shù)為 4 次。主洗過程是一個包括進水、洗滌、排水洗和脫水全過程。洗衣機的洗滌過程是否進 入到主洗程序模塊,由用戶操作決定。若按下啟動鍵,則洗衣機開始洗滌。若不設(shè)定的話,洗衣機啟動后處于標準洗滌狀態(tài)。若為洗滌過程中掉電,則上電后進行恢復斷點工作,否則 程序返回進入到對按鍵監(jiān)視和刷新顯示的循環(huán)過程中。因為洗衣機上電后默認洗滌方式為標準洗,故參數(shù)初始化主要是對標準洗狀態(tài)下的參數(shù)的預置。程序首先運行在監(jiān)控程序模塊中。 監(jiān)控程序模塊的流程圖如圖 41所示。在監(jiān)控狀態(tài)下,程序不斷掃描 7 個按鍵(電源、啟動、程序、預約、水位、功能和水溫 )的狀態(tài)。 16 第四章 系統(tǒng) 軟件設(shè)計 軟件編程思路 全自動洗衣機控制軟件系統(tǒng)根據(jù)其功能要求,主要分為以下幾個大程序模塊:監(jiān)控程序模塊;主洗程序模塊;漂洗程序模塊;脫水程序模塊。 在按鍵 的輸入處均設(shè)有容阻吸收電路,以提高系統(tǒng)抗干擾能力。根據(jù)掃描方波,可判斷按下的是哪一個鍵,然后 調(diào)出存在程序存貯器中的相應按鍵子程序。 同時,軟件不斷檢測 P2 P47 的輸入。掃描信號經(jīng)限流電阻 R1~ R6()后加載到三極管 Q1~ Q6 的基極。 開機后,由 P30~P32 和 P35~P37 輸出不同時段的掃描方波 ,用來檢測按鍵的輸入。即讓各位數(shù)碼管及 LED 顯示器件按照一定順序輪流顯示,只要掃描 頻率足夠高,由于人眼的“視覺暫留”特性,就觀察不到閃爍現(xiàn)象,而是連續(xù)穩(wěn)定的顯示。 采用動態(tài)掃描顯示的方法。 LED和數(shù)碼管顯示及按鍵電路 如圖 35 所示, 本程控器設(shè)有七個按鍵 (水位 K程序 K功能 K水溫 K啟動 /暫停 K預約 K電源 K7),十四個發(fā)光二極管(四個 八檔水位顯示、三個程序顯示、四個功能顯示、兩個進水顯示、一個預約顯示),一個雙位數(shù)碼管,實現(xiàn)對洗衣機運行狀態(tài)的選擇和顯示。其工作原理是 :將水位的高低通過導管轉(zhuǎn)換成一個測試內(nèi)腔氣體變化的壓力 ,驅(qū)動內(nèi)腔上方的一塊隔膜移動 ,帶動隔膜中心的磁芯在某線圈內(nèi)移動 ,從而線圈電感發(fā)生變化。對于全自動洗衣機 ,要求水位的檢測必須是連續(xù)的 ,故常采用諧振式水位傳感器。在洗衣機電源接通后,單片機就不斷地對接收到的按鍵、門開關(guān)、水位傳感器等輸入信號進行分析,并結(jié)合內(nèi)部時鐘信號,作出當前工作狀態(tài)是否正常的判斷,若出現(xiàn)異常情況,則進行蜂鳴報警。 如圖 321,在雙向晶閘管的兩端并聯(lián) RC 串聯(lián)網(wǎng)絡(luò),該網(wǎng)絡(luò)常稱為 RC 阻容吸收電路。 由于電機的電感較大,感應反電勢也較大,如果這個電壓出現(xiàn)非常迅速,則雙向晶閘管將重新導通而失去控制,因此需要在兩個 8A的雙向晶閘管的兩個主極上并聯(lián)一個電阻和電容,組成容阻回路。這時,只要交流電壓一過零點,可控硅就因 T1和 G間電壓 為零而自動截止,電磁閥不帶電而關(guān)閉閥門。 同樣道理,當 P10 腳輸出高電平過零脈沖時,熱進水閥閥門打開。當 P34 腳輸出高電平過零脈沖時,可控制排水牽引器的啟動停止。此時,只要交流電壓一過 零點,可控硅就因T1和 G間電壓為零而自動截止,電動機失電停止運轉(zhuǎn)。 同樣道理,當 P13 腳輸出高電平過零脈沖時,電動機反轉(zhuǎn)。 220V交流電路經(jīng)過負載形成回路,使相應的負載得電運行。 電路中的雙向可控 硅分別控制電機正轉(zhuǎn)、反轉(zhuǎn),進水(熱水、冷水)電磁閥、排水牽引器的通斷。 雙向晶閘管采用直流觸發(fā), 鑒于單片機輸出觸發(fā)信號不足以觸發(fā)雙向晶閘管,故需將觸發(fā)功率放大。當門極無信號輸入時,它與 SCR 相同,在 MT2 與 MT1 之間不導通。通常以 MT1作為電壓測量的基準點。 10 表 32 I/O 口資源分配表 I/O 引腳 功能 P40 P41 P42 P43 P44 P45 P46 9 10 11 12 13 14 15 輸出,七段 LED 數(shù)碼管顯示 其中, ~ 兼作水位、功能、程序、進水的狀態(tài)顯示 P22 P47 23 16 輸入,第 1 行按鍵 K1~ K6 輸入 輸入,第 2 行按鍵 K7 輸入 P30 P31 P32 P35 P36 P37 40 41 42 3 4 5 輸出,第 6 列按鍵及低位數(shù)碼管顯示控制 輸出,第 5 列按鍵及高位數(shù)碼管顯示控制 輸出,第 4 列按鍵及進水狀態(tài)顯示控制 輸出,第 1 列按鍵及水位狀態(tài)顯示控制 輸出,第 2 列按鍵及程序狀態(tài)顯示控制 輸出,第 3 列按鍵及功能狀態(tài)顯示控制 P34 P10 P12 P13 P14 2 39 37 36 35 輸出,排水電磁閥驅(qū)動電路控制 輸出,熱水進水電磁閥驅(qū)動電路控制 輸出,冷水進水電磁閥驅(qū)動電路控制 輸出,電機正轉(zhuǎn)驅(qū)動電路控制 輸出,電機反轉(zhuǎn)驅(qū)動電路控制 P15 34 輸出,繼電器線圈通斷電控制 P00 26 輸入 ,交流過零檢測信號輸入 P01 27 輸出,蜂鳴器控制 P20 25 輸入,水位傳感器頻率信號輸入 P21 22 輸入,門開關(guān)檢測信號輸入 雙向晶閘管控制驅(qū)動電路設(shè)計 雙向晶閘管的結(jié)構(gòu)及工作原理 雙向晶閘管的結(jié)構(gòu)如下圖所示。 而顯示及控制驅(qū)動 電路需要輸出控制及驅(qū)動信號,所以相應的 I/O口設(shè)置為輸出口。 8 圖 32 TMP86C846N 引腳排列圖 表 31 為 TMP86C846N 引腳功能說明。通過不同顏色接插件與洗衣機的冷熱進水電磁閥、排水牽引器、電機、水位傳感器、安全門開關(guān)相連接,由雙向晶閘管來控制負載,按設(shè)定程序?qū)崟r執(zhí)行動作。 鑒于晶閘管自身不可替代的優(yōu)點,在本控制系統(tǒng)中,采用雙向晶閘管作為開關(guān)器件來控制電機的正反轉(zhuǎn)及各種電磁閥的通斷。普通開關(guān)的壽命和開斷的次數(shù)相關(guān),因此在頻繁切換的場合其應用受到了一定的限制。 普通開關(guān)設(shè)備,均屬于有觸點開關(guān)。 因此我們選擇 TMP86C846N單片機作為主芯片。若用 Intel 的 51 系列單片機,要么需要進行 I/O 擴展,要么由于這些單片機驅(qū)動能力有限,需外加驅(qū)動電路,從而使硬件電路過于復雜。 ( 2)東芝 (TOSHIBA)公司的單片機 東芝公司主要有 TLCS870、 TLCS870/X、 TLCS870/C 等系列的 8 位單片機,TLCS900 系列的 16 位單片機,這些單片機是近幾年推出的新型單片機,功能強、可靠性高。在 20 世紀八、九十年代, MCS51 和 MCS96 曾經(jīng)是我國最流行的單片機,得到廣泛的應用。程序按鍵對應的三個燈也是如此,一個燈可以表示兩個狀態(tài)。 冷、熱進水功能設(shè)計 5 冷水燈亮進水時,由冷水進水閥打開;熱水燈亮進水時,由熱水進水閥打開;冷、熱水燈同時亮則進水時兩進水閥同時打開。 童鎖功能設(shè)計 程序啟動后,按水位&功能鍵即可啟動童鎖功能。打開電源,在未啟動狀態(tài)下,按程序&預約鍵可選則桶潔凈功能,然后按啟 /停鍵即進入潔桶程序。 表 12 運動浸泡的洗滌方式 浸泡過程( 20' ) 攪拌 2' 浸泡 3' 攪拌 1' 浸泡 4' 攪拌 2' 浸泡 3' 攪拌 1' 浸泡 4' 故障報警功能設(shè)計 在洗衣機工作過程中,若出現(xiàn)表 13所列的故障,則單片機能檢測故障類型,同時發(fā)出報警信號,提醒操作者排除故障。 運動浸泡功能設(shè)計 其洗滌方式是首先預備洗滌攪拌,然后浸泡 ,攪拌 ,如此循環(huán)。 自動斷電功能設(shè)計 啟動自動斷電功能的工作情況: 第一,開機 10 分鐘后,不啟動程序,則自動切斷電源。同時, 注水到當前設(shè)定水位后, 擺平水流運行 1 分鐘,結(jié)束后排水回到原來脫水行程中。斷開不足 40ms,不 4 予處理。 不平衡調(diào)整功能設(shè)計 不平衡調(diào)整的判斷 在安全開關(guān)接通的狀態(tài)下,若間歇脫水或脫水過程中,出現(xiàn) 45?5~ 200?10ms 的瞬間斷開,則進入不平衡調(diào)整狀態(tài)。按住預約鍵不放,時間自動連續(xù)增加,可一次設(shè)置 1~ 48 小時。每按一次預約鍵,預約時間增加 1 小時。 27 分鐘 羊毛 洗滌 15 分鐘,漂洗 2 次,免脫水 (僅排水 ), 適合洗滌羊毛衫。 33 分鐘 大物 洗滌 15 分鐘,漂洗 2 次,脫水 7 分鐘, 洗滌能力特別強。 43 分鐘 快洗 洗滌 分鐘,漂洗 1 次并噴淋,脫水 分鐘, 洗凈能力較輕。 ( 4)洗衣機的電源電壓為 220 伏特, 50 赫茲。變頻控制依其高性能、節(jié)能等優(yōu)點在洗衣機的控制中得到廣泛應用,而單片機在洗 衣機中的控制做用是決定性作用的。 關(guān)鍵字 :東芝;單片機;雙向晶閘管;軟件編程; 2 Abstract: automatic washing machine with a puter programmed by Toshiba SCM control.
點擊復制文檔內(nèi)容
教學教案相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1